NEW YORK CITY, NY – The 2025 Met Gala is set for May 5, 2025, at the Metropolitan Museum of Art, celebrating the theme “Superfine: Tailoring Black Style.” This year’s exhibition focuses on the style, politics, and history surrounding Black men’s fashion.

With a ticket price of $75,000, the event attracts top celebrities and fashion enthusiasts. Guests are scheduled to arrive between 5:30 p.m. and 8 p.m. ET. The red carpet can be streamed live on platforms like Vogue’s YouTube channel and E!.

Singer and actor Teyana Taylor, actor La La Anthony, and “Saturday Night Live” star Ego Nwodim will host the Met Gala livestream. The exhibition, inspired by Monica L. Miller‘s 2009 book “Slaves to Fashion,” aims to explore how Black style signifies identity and power.

Miller highlighted that, historically, tailored clothing was scarce for Black individuals, making tailors vital in their communities. The gala’s dress code, “Tailored For You,” emphasizes the importance of well-fitted menswear.

This year’s event will spotlight a variety of styles, from the zoot suit popularized in the 1940s jazz era to the vibrant ensembles of Congolese sapeurs. Celebrities like A$AP Rocky, Pharrell Williams, and Lewis Hamilton will serve as co-chairs, with LeBron James as an honorary co-chair.

The exclusive guest list remains under wraps but typically includes hundreds of stars, including frequent attendees like Rihanna and Zendaya. However, some, like Jack Schlossberg, have opted to boycott this year’s gala due to global and domestic issues.
